(i >> worked 3 months on it and gave up) >> at the end (i was working on a cavium octeon platform at that time) i just >> switched the kernel boot to little endian which is possible on many ppc >> platforms too. > The 'ath11k' driver works a bit differently. The endian swap is implemented in > the firmware and was never properly tested. My investigations show that the > firmware does not handle the swap consistently. According to 'kvalo', different > firmware versions treat the swap differently. See [1]. > > With 'ath12k', the situation looks better. Unfortunately, there are still some > memcpys from u32 to u8 or similar. Also, reading from DMA memory is not swapped. > I already have ath12k running, I get ping responses and can transmit data. > However, not in all modes, and there are still some bugs I’m trying to iron out. > > > Best regards > Alexander Wilhelm > > --- > [1] https://lore.kernel.org/ath11k/68290980-5bfb-c88c-be78-954f9591c135@westermo.com/T/#u >
